How to use neem leaves for chickenpox treatment?

Another way to use neem for chickenpox treatment is to extract the juice of neem leaves and applying it on the skin. Application of neem leaves the juice on the skin is effective in reducing the scars and decreasing the chances of infection from spreading.

How to make neem juice at home?

Follow the steps to make neem juice in a proper way: Once you have collected the fresh neem leaves, just wash them using clean water. Put the leaves in a strainer to remove the excess water in it. Take a mixer jar and place the clean neem leaves in it. Pour an equal quantity of water i.e., 1 cup of water for 1 cup of neem leaves.

What is the best natural treatment for chicken pox?

Neem (Azadirachta indica) A decoction from the leaves of Neem tops the list of herbal remedies for Chicken pox and other skin diseases. Other herbal remedies include Allium cepa (onion), Allium sativum (garlic), rhizomes of Curcuma longa (turmeric), and Aloe vera.
